After Embakasi East MP Babu Owino was freed on bond, a section of Nairobians, who are against his release have put up banners as a way of criticizing the Judiciary’s way of handling cases.
This banners has been put up in major routes heading to CBD.
The one that was put up along Jogoo road near Muthurwa, questions the integrity of the Judiciary urging that majority of the inmates in Kenya prisons are the poor adding that it’s time for all the corrupt Judges to be laid off.
“Why is the majority of inmates in #Kenya the poor people? We demand a working judiciary free of corrupt judges now!,”reads the writings on the banner.
While the one on Mombasa road near Nyayo Stadium disclose that the Akashas brothers, who were jailed by USA court lived freely in Kenya despite being connected with drug trafficking.
Babu Owino’s release
Babu Owino was released on a Sh10 million cash bail in a case where he is accused of shooting Felix Orinda alias DJ Evolve at a city club on January 17.
He was on January 20 committed to remand after denying unlawfully attempting to cause the death of a Nairobi DJ and carrying a firearm while drunk and disorderly after shooting at Nairobi’s B-Club on January 17.
